This is a Topic relating to a broken plaster mold of mine “Diablo Mold”. It was shattered into 30 or more pieces by a UPS worker whom I witnessed, slammed my box on the back of the truck while delivereing (Written in BIG-RED “Fragile Delivery” mine you).
Anyways I’m writing this to inform anyone shipping a mold of any kind, or mask to your fellow members or for yourself.
Masks can melt in the heat inside a box, or your box may even be damaged ruining an item, or your item may fall out of a box.
Well UPS picked up my damaged mold for inspection 3 weeks ago, it is sitting at the UPS inspections (which is 2,000 miles away from me). I’m still waiting for word on how much they are giving me back for the damage if anything.
ON TOP of this, they don’t want to give me MY property back! UNLESS I PAY TO HAVE IT SHIPPED BACK TO MYSELF AGAIN - this time from inspections — how many times do they want me to pay them it was $60 to ship last time and they broke my item, now they want me to pay $60 to have my broken item shipped from their INSPECTIONS!!! I called the manager and he said if people dont **pay to have their items re-delivered from the Inspections Offices, they keep your property or just throw it away. So it looks like I have to cough up another $60 to have my broken stuff sent back to me or they just ‘toss’ my mold. (I know it’s broken, but it’s my property and i want it back free at their cost - not mine).
So I hope this gives you ALL, a better idea on what options to choose on shipping anything wether it be USPS, UPS FED-EX (BEware and learn all the policies, before any company Abuses your property without proper care). Moreover, no matter how much you pay for insurance as i did, they still get to decide on whether to give you your money back or Not - Which I have not a penny.
